President’s Day, 2017

Presidents Day
Clipart image

Today we commemorate the chiefs of state of the United States of America.

Three days ago C-SPAN produced their latest survey of historians ranking the Presidents. Here’s a commentary on that survey.  While political bias skews the results, there are deeper problems with this.

  1. Some of the Presidents did not get a fair chance.  They were not able to serve full terms.  Anyone who did not serve a full term of office should be given an incomplete.  Their records simply cannot compare.Why was Kennedy ranked at #8? Celebrity and politics — you know that’s true.
  2. Lack of objective criteria.  While Economic Performance can have some numbers supporting a ranking, how does one factor in “assists”.  — A Presidential Term laying the foundation for future economic growth.
  3. Moral leadership.  The slavery issue would put all the Presidents before Lincoln to the bottom; even Lincoln would have to be downgraded based on his equivocal policy before Emancipation.  For recent President, what should make of similar equivocal policies on social justice issues?

Ranking has it’s problems. Here is the survey.
